Several days ago, Adhesive Games announced the new Wreckage Map for the free-to-play mech FPS, Hawken. Today, Adhesive Games released...
Meteor Entertainment
Developer Adhesive Games has released the massive Ascension game update for its shooter, Hawken. In addition, a new trailer as...